Educación para un Sinaloa intercultural

open access: yesLATAM Revista Latinoamericana de Ciencias Sociales y Humanidades
La educación superior intercultural en México representa un avance significativo en el reconocimiento y valoración de la diversidad cultural del país. Sin embargo, aún queda mucho por hacer para garantizar que todos los grupos culturales tengan acceso a una educación de calidad que respete y promueva sus identidades y cosmovisiones.
